Recent Situation at a local company: In a company when someone is hired or gets a promotion it's normal policy that the manager and Human Resource Department notify all parties involved before general employees are notified. This is considered "common courtesy" and helps managers provide a smooth transition. For example: what if you-the student, found out your teacher was being replaced ... and your teacher knew nothing of this. Recently, something similar happen at a local company. Within the last month the "ABC company" interviewed a candidate for a Site Engineering Managers position at their headquarters in North Carolina. The candidate was excited about being hired and posted the name of the company and title he was hired for, on his online resume. Someone from the "ABC Company" noticed the resume . . . the man being replaced had not been notified, none of the engineers in the group were aware of this either. This posting put the company in a very awkward position.
